Protecting Northborough from the Asian Longhorn Beetle

by Kim

Photo by Jennifer Forman Orth of Mass Dept of Agricultural Resources

In Northern Worcester (Area within: 190, East Mountain Street, Quinapoxet Lane) clear cutting of hardwoods continues to stem the spread of Asian Longhorn Beetles.  The beetles nest and feed on maples, chestnuts, birches, poplars, willows, elms, ashes, and sycamores; larvae eat the heartwood [...]
